1. Adaptive Luminescence & Smart IoT Integration

Traditional illuminated signs maintain a single brightness level throughout the day, which can lead to glare at night or poor contrast under direct midday sunlight. The industry is moving towards smart signage systems equipped with ambient light sensors and programmable DALI (Digital Addressable Lighting Interface) controllers. These systems dynamically adjust light output, optimizing legibility, reducing power consumption by up to 45%, and extending the lifespan of LED chips.

2. Shift Toward Sustainable & Recyclable Materials

Global corporations face strict environmental compliance targets. Consequently, signage manufacturing is shifting toward circular economy principles. Our R&D team is continually qualifying bio-based PMMA and recycled acrylics that deliver the same light transmission and UV-stabilization performance as virgin acrylic. Combined with mercury-free, RoHS-compliant LED chips and recyclable aluminium chassis, we provide brands with sustainable, low-carbon physical signage options.

3. Transition to High-Density COB and Faux Neon Technologies

Conventional LED strip configurations often suffer from "dotting" (uneven light spots through the acrylic diffuser). Advanced manufacturers are adopting high-density Chip-on-Board (COB) LEDs and specialized silicone-diffused 3D faux neon, enabling uniform light distribution even in ultra-thin, low-profile signs down to 15mm deep.

Understanding UL & CE Standards for LED Signage

For North American buyers, UL Certification ensures that all electrical components, insulation barriers, power supplies, and wiring routing comply with strict fire prevention and electrical shock mitigation guidelines. Similarly, the CE Mark represents compliance with European health, safety, and environmental protection standards. Sourcing certified signs ensures smooth customs clearance, simplified municipal inspection approvals, and reduced liability risk.

Material Science: UV-Stabilized PMMA Acrylics

Acrylic signs are prone to yellowing, embrittlement, and cracking when exposed to outdoor solar UV radiation. We mitigate this by using exclusively UV-stabilized, high-grade PMMA (Polymethyl Methacrylate) sheets with a light transmission rating of over 92%. This ensures the colours remain vibrant, and the structural integrity is maintained for over 5 to 7 years in high-UV regions like Australia, South America, and the Middle East.

Q2: How do your custom acrylic signs compare to traditional neon signs in energy efficiency and safety?

Modern LED Faux Neon and 3D Acrylic signs offer key advantages over traditional gas-discharge glass neon:

  • Energy Efficiency: LED systems consume 70% to 80% less electricity than high-voltage glass neon transformers, leading to significant operating cost savings.
  • Safety: Our signs run on 12V or 24V Class 2 low-voltage DC power, reducing electrical fire risks and shock hazards. Traditional neon, by contrast, operates on high-voltage AC (up to 15,000 volts).
  • Durability: PMMA acrylic is highly impact-resistant and shatterproof, whereas fragile glass neon tubes are prone to breakage during transport, installation, or high winds.

Q5: How does your factory handle quality control during production?

Our quality control process is managed across four stages:

  1. IQC (Incoming Quality Control): Testing all raw PMMA sheets, metal frames, and LED lots for compliance, colour consistency, and output stability.
  2. IPQC (In-Process Quality Control): Checking dimensional tolerances, seam welding, and silicone weather-sealing during assembly.
  3. Burn-In Aging: Every sign undergoes a continuous 24-to-48 hour burn-in test to identify and resolve any premature component failures.
  4. FQC (Final Quality Control): A comprehensive evaluation of structural integrity, waterproof seals, electrical insulation resistance, and visual cosmetics before custom wooden-crate packing.
